Integrated Environmental and Energy Assessment of an ORC-CCHP System Using Agricultural Residues for Rural Decarbonization in Sucre, Colombia

Short Introductive summary

Agricultural residues in Colombia’s Sucre Department present significant potential for sustainable energy generation. The municipalities were grouped into North, Center, and South regions. Only the North and South exhibit intensive agricultural activity, while the Center focuses on cattle raising. This study integrates life cycle assessment (LCA) and thermodynamic simulation of an Organic Rankine Cycle (ORC-CCHP) system fueled by cassava, oil palm, and rice residues. Simulations in Aspen Plus V14 using R1233zd(E) and Dowtherm Q achieved electrical efficiencies of 7.13% in the North and 8.11% in the South, with trigeneration efficiencies surpassing 30%. LCA modeling in SimaPro v.9 indicated that the Northern scenario could reduce climate change impacts by 21% compared to conventional electricity. The Southern scenario revealed higher environmental burdens due to diesel consumption in straw baling. The total biomass potential of the department is estimated at 944,249 MWh/year. This capacity could supply electricity to approximately 428 households in the South and 32 in the North. The South region offers a considerable energy surplus suitable for agro-industrial expansion.
